Wall dismantling services involve the careful removal of interior or exterior walls within a property. This process typically requires specialized tools and techniques to ensure the wall is taken down safely and efficiently. Whether the wall is load-bearing or non-structural, experienced contractors can assess the situation and execute the dismantling with minimal disruption to the rest of the property. This service is often necessary during renovations, remodeling projects, or when creating open-concept spaces to improve the flow and functionality of a home or commercial building.

Many property owners turn to wall dismantling services to resolve specific problems. For example, removing an outdated or damaged wall can eliminate obstructions that hinder movement or reduce the natural light in a room. It can also be a solution for expanding a space or creating a more open layout. In some cases, walls need to be taken down to access hidden utilities, such as wiring or plumbing, for repairs or upgrades. Professional contractors can handle these tasks safely, ensuring that structural integrity is maintained and that the work complies with local building codes.

This type of service is commonly used in a variety of properties, including single-family homes, multi-unit residential buildings, and commercial spaces. Homeowners may seek wall dismantling when renovating kitchens, living rooms, or basements to modernize their interiors. Property developers and business owners might use it to reconfigure office layouts or retail spaces to better suit their needs. Regardless of the property type, trained service providers can evaluate the scope of work and perform the dismantling efficiently, helping property owners achieve their renovation goals.

The overview below groups typical Wall Dismantling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Wentzville, MO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Wall Dismantling - For minor wall removal projects,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for non-structural or partial dismantling tasks. Larger or more complex projects may cost more depending on accessibility and materials.

Moderate Dismantling Projects - Mid-sized wall removal jobs often range from $600 to $2,000. These projects usually involve partial dismantling of interior walls or non-load-bearing structures.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this range, which may include additional cleanup or reinforcement work.

Full Wall Removal and Dismantling - Complete removal of interior or exterior walls can cost between $2,000 and $5,000. Many contractors handle these larger projects within this range, though costs can increase with the complexity of the structure and site conditions. Larger, more involved jobs may exceed this range in some cases.

Heavy-Duty or Structural Wall Dismantling - For major dismantling involving load-bearing or exterior walls, costs can reach $5,000 or more. These projects are less common and typically involve significant planning and reinforcement, leading to higher expenses based on project scope and local labor rates.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ing wall dismantling service providers in Wentzville, MO,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about how many wall removal jobs they have completed and whether they have worked on projects comparable in size and complexity. An experienced contractor will have a clear understanding of the necessary techniques and potential challenges, helping to ensure the work is handled efficiently and effectively. Gathering information about their background with comparable projects can provide confidence that they are well-equipped to manage the specific demands of the job.

Clear, written expectations are crucial when selecting a wall dismantling service provider. Homeowners should seek detailed descriptions of the scope of work, including what is included and what is not, along with any preparations or post-job cleanup. Having these expectations documented hel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is aligned on the project’s objectives. It’s also helpful to ask for reputable references from previous clients, which can provide insights into the contractor’s reliability, quality of work, and professionalism.

Good communication is a key factor in a successful project. Service providers who are responsive, transparent, and willing to answer questions can make the process smoother and less stressful. Homeowners should look for contractors who are approachable and willing to provide clear explanations about their methods and processes. What does wall dismantling involve? Wall dismantling typically includes safely removing interior or exterior walls, which may involve taking down drywall, framing, and other structural components, depending on the project scope.

Are wall dismantling services suitable for both residential and commercial properties? Yes, local contractors often handle wall dismantling for a variety of property types, including homes, offices, and retail spaces.

What should I consider before hiring a wall dismantling service? It’s important to assess the wall’s location, purpose, and any potential impact on surrounding structures or utilities before engaging a contractor.

Can wall dismantling be combined with other renovation services? Yes, many service providers offer additional services such as remodeling, electrical work, or flooring installation to complement wall removal projects.
